What does the L_Trade emoji mean?

The ultimate symbol for taking that massive L.

The L_Trade emoji is a staple in gaming and trading communities, used to signify a loss, a bad deal, or a failed attempt. It draws from the internet slang 'taking an L,' which originated in hip-hop culture and became a universal marker for defeat or embarrassment in competitive Discord servers.

When to use it

  • Acknowledging a bad trade in a server
  • Admitting defeat after a tough gaming match
  • Mocking someone who made a poor decision
  • Reacting to a failed attempt at something

How to add this emoji

Add to Discord
  1. Click Download PNG above to save the L_Trade image.
  2. Open Discord and go to Server Settings โ†’ Emoji.
  3. Click Upload Emoji and choose the downloaded file.
  4. Give it a name and save. You need the Manage Emojis and Stickers permission.
